This talk was given at a local TEDx event, produced independently of the TED Conferences. Marianne Jylha presents how dyslexia as a learning disorder impacts the people afflicted by the condition and how specific learning methods can be utilized to heighten learning aptitude.
Marianne Jylha founded Great Minds Learning Center (non-profit) in 2011 as a place for struggling students to receive intense interventions for reading, writing and spelling. She graduated from University of Wisconsin-Superior (1991) with a B.S. Degree in Elementary Education/Reading and Language Arts. Marianne is currently enrolled in the Master of Education program through St. Scholastica.
